3ـ أَحْمَدُ بْنُ مُحَمَّدٍ عَنِ الْحَسَنِ بْنِ عَلِيٍّ عَنِ ابْنِ بُكَيْرٍ عَنْ إِبْرَاهِيمَ بْنِ الْحَسَنِ عَنْ أَبِي عَبْدِ الله (عَلَيْهِ السَّلاَم) قَالَ إِنَّ الْمُحْرِمَ إِذَا تَزَوَّجَ وَهُوَ مُحْرِمٌ فُرِّقَ بَيْنَهُمَا ثُمَّ لا يَتَعَاوَدَانِ أَبَداً.
3. Ahmad ibn Muhammad from has narrated from al-Hassan ibn Ali from ibn Bukayr from Ibrahim ibn al-Hassan who has said the following: “Abu ‘Abd Allah (a.s.), has said that if one in the state of Ihram gets married, and he is still in the state of Ihram, they are separated and they can never marry each other again.’”
